The Ultimate Guide To Drive From Apex, NC To Florence, SC

Welcome to my blog post, folks! If you're planning a road trip from Apex, North Carolina to Florence, South Carolina, then buckle up and get ready to learn all the relevant details. From the fastest routes to travel times, I've got you covered. Let's dive in!

Fastest vs. Slowest Routes

There are two major routes you can take to reach Florence, SC from Apex, NC. The first route, via I-95 S, is the fastest and more commonly used. The distance of this route is approximately 150 miles and could take around 2 hours and 30 minutes, depending on traffic. However, if you take the scenic route via US-1 and US-15/501 S, it'll take you approximately 3 hours to reach your destination, covering a distance of around 170 miles.

If you're in a hurry or want to reach Florence as soon as possible, the I-95 S route should be your go-to choice. On the other hand, if you want to enjoy the journey, stop at some scenic points, or wish to avoid traffic, you can take the longer but scenic route.

Travel Time Based On Traffic Patterns

The travel time between Apex and Florence can vary based on the time of day, and traffic jams can add to the travel time. If you're traveling during peak hours, which typically fall between 7 am-9 am and 4 pm-7 pm, expect more traffic and longer travel times. If you're traveling during off-peak hours, say around 10 am or 2 pm, there will likely be less traffic and a shorter travel time.

During peak hours, the trip via I-95 S may take up to 3 hours while the alternative route via US-1 and US-15/501 S might take closer to 4 hours. However, if you're traveling during off-peak hours, the I-95 S route may take only 2 ½ hours, while the US-1 and US-15/501 S route would only take slightly over three hours.
